What is under a suspended floor?

look at this now

A suspended floor is a ground floor with a void underneath the structure. The floor can be formed in various ways, using timber joists, precast concrete panels, block and beam system or cast in-situ with reinforced concrete. However, the floor structure is supported by external and internal walls.

How thick should insulation be in floors?

Building Regulations
would require at least 70 mm of high-performance foam insulation, or 150 mm of mineral wool, (although this will vary depending on floor type, construction, shape and size).

To remedy this problem the moisture contained within the heat air from the dwelling space must be prevented from being carried through into the sub flooring space. The only feasible approach to obtain that is to insert a vapour barrier. There is a chilly space (sub-flooring space) with a warm area above. Sandwiched between these two areas is the Rockwool and naturally there might be a temperature gradient throughout it - from virtually room temperature at the higher stage to outside temperature at the lower level.
